FNB Zambia has officially launched the 2nd edition of the FNB Zambia Visual Arts Competition, a national initiative designed to showcase Zambia’s creative talent while promoting cultural pride and economic opportunities for local artists.
This year’s competition will run from 17th September to 17th October 2025 and is targeted at secondary school learners aged between 13 and 20 years old, to encourage artistic expression among learners by providing them with a platform to showcase their creativity under the theme “Next Is Now.”
Through this platform, FNB Zambia is reinforcing its commitment to Shared Prosperity by investing in art and culture as key drivers of community development.
Speaking about the launch, FNB Zambia Head of Strategic Marketing and Communication Kasali M. Kaingu stated that “Art is more than expression, it is empowerment, identity, and a powerful voice for our communities. With this competition, we are creating a platform for young Zambians to shine, while also reminding the nation that creativity has a place in building our future economy.”
The top three winners of the competition will not only receive exciting prizes but also gain a unique opportunity to travel to South Africa to experience and appreciate art, broadening their horizons and offering valuable international exposure.
The competition is being undertaken in partnership with the Zambia National Arts Council through the Visual Arts Council, which will serve as technical partners to ensure authenticity, credibility, and fair judging throughout the process.
